Thomas MacGillivray is a leading researcher in human-robot interaction (HRI), with a particular focus on the psychological and experiential factors that shape how people trust and collaborate with robotic agents. His most-cited work, "Trust and Prior Experience in Human-Robot Interaction" (2017, 54 citations), experimentally demonstrates that users with prior interaction experience exhibit higher trust scores and more nuanced trust calibration when observing a robot perform tasks. This foundational contribution has helped shift the field toward understanding trust as a dynamic, experience-driven process rather than a static attitude.
